Finally printed an extruder design that worked well right away, but the bolt-on tabs are slightly too long and need 0.5mm trimming. The tabs attach to grooves in the x carriage, providing a quick 3-second extruder removal by twisting and lifting. No additional hardware is required, and with proper printing, it holds as well as a stock carriage. Photos show an extruder without a nozzle for easier viewing. Update: After five months, the extruder has not wobbled loose, even with one lock breaking off. Update 2: Nearly three years later, a part failed due to a tab breaking when forced into place too tightly. A washer recommendation is given to add strength and rigidity between the bolt head and plastic. To install, print the STL (adjust tolerance settings as needed), create additional tabs for other extruders, attach tabs to the carriage instead of bolting the extruder directly, line up with slots on top, push in, twist to install or reverse to remove.
